Why do Pomeranians cry so much?

A stressed Pomeranian will often whine. If your Pom is whining and you know she doesn’t have to go outside to go potty, she may be stressed. Stress whining can turn into barking or crying as well.

How can I tell if my Pomeranian has an upset tummy?

(If Sophia sleeps in past 8:30am I know somethings wrong! She is a ball full of energy in the mornings!) Some other key signs that dealing with a Pomeranian with an upset tummy is a loose stool, they may be throwing up, have no appetite/not eating dog food, and drinking an excess amount of water.

When to take a Pomeranian to the vet?

Make sure and keep a close eye on the water bowl, so that it’s always full. If your Pomeranian’s stomach isn’t feeling better with in a day or two and he/she still can’t keep anything down or if they are not eating, I suggest you call the vet and make an appointment.

When to call the vet for your Pomeranian?

If you see that your Pomeranian is walking a little funny or has pain when they walk it is a good idea to have the checked for Patellar Luxation. This symptoms aren’t that noticeable at first and may just happen occasionally. So if there is any signs call your Vet right away.

What to do if Pomeranian has spams in his rear-back problems?

Rimadyl is a good medication to help reduce inflammation. Often a course of Rimadyl will do the trick. However, I do get concerned when a back problem improves and then suddenly gets worse. When this happens it may mean that there is more than just inflammation going on.

Are there any medical issues with my Pomeranian?

The next Pomeranian health problem that we’ll discuss is patellar luxation. If you notice that your Pomeranian is having trouble walking, particularly with. the rear legs, then this may be a looming medical issue.
